What is Google Play Store APK TV Android?




Google Play Store APK is a file format that contains the installation package of the Google Play Store app. APK stands for Android Package Kit, and it is the standard format for distributing and installing apps on Android devices. You can think of it as a zip file that contains all the necessary files and instructions for an app to run on your device.

How to install Google Play Store APK on your Android TV




If you have decided to use Google Play Store APK on your Android TV, you will need to follow some steps to install it on your device. Here is a simple guide on how to do it:


Step 1: Enable unknown sources on your Android TV




Before you can install any APK file on your Android TV, you need to enable the option to allow unknown sources on your device. This will let you install apps from sources other than the Google Play Store. To do this, follow these steps:



  • Go to the Settings menu on your Android TV.



  • Select Security & restrictions under Device Preferences.



  • Toggle on the option to Allow unknown sources.



  • Select the file manager app that you will use to install the APK file, such as ES File Explorer, X-plore File Manager, or Solid Explorer.



  • Toggle on the option to Allow from this source for the file manager app.



You have now enabled unknown sources on your Android TV. You can proceed to the next step.


Step 2: Download Google Play Store APK from a trusted source




The next step is to download the Google Play Store APK file from a trusted source. You can use your computer or your phone to do this. You can choose any version of the Google Play Store APK that you want, but make sure that it is compatible with your device and region. You can find the latest versions of the Google Play Store APK on websites such as APKMirror, APKPure, or Aptoide. To download the APK file, follow these steps:



  • Go to the website that offers the Google Play Store APK file that you want.



  • Search for the Google Play Store app and select the version that you want.



  • Click on the Download button and save the APK file to your computer or phone.



You have now downloaded the Google Play Store APK file. You can proceed to the next step.


Step 3: Transfer the APK file to your Android TV using a USB drive or a cloud service




The next step is to transfer the APK file to your Android TV using a USB drive or a cloud service. You can use any method that works for you, but here are two common ways to do it:



  • Using a USB drive: Copy the APK file from your computer or phone to a USB drive. Plug the USB drive into your Android TV. Use a file manager app on your Android TV to locate and access the USB drive. Find and select the APK file that you want to install.



  • Using a cloud service: Upload the APK file from your computer or phone to a cloud service, such as Google Drive, Dropbox, or OneDrive. Install and sign in to the same cloud service app on your Android TV. Use the cloud service app on your Android TV to locate and access the APK file that you want to install.



You have now transferred the APK file to your Android TV. You can proceed to the next step.


Step 4: Install the APK file using a file manager app on your Android TV




The final step is to install the APK file using a file manager app on your Android TV. You can use any file manager app that you like, but here are some popular ones that you can try: ES File Explorer, X-plore File Manager, or Solid Explorer. To install the APK file, follow these steps:



  • Open the file manager app on your Android TV.



  • Navigate to the folder where you have stored or accessed the APK file.



  • Select the APK file that you want to install and tap on it.



  • A prompt will appear asking you if you want to install this application. Tap on Install.

  • The installation process will begin and may take a few minutes to complete.



  • Once the installation is done, a prompt will appear saying that the app has been installed. Tap on Done or Open to finish or launch the app.



Congratulations! You have successfully installed Google Play Store APK on your Android TV. You can now use it to download and install apps on your smart TV.

How to install apps on your Android TV from your phone using Google Play Store




Another way to install apps on your Android TV is to use your phone and the Google Play Store app. This method does not require you to download or install any APK files on your device. You can use this method to install apps that are available on the official version of the Google Play Store. To install apps on your Android TV from your phone using Google Play Store, follow these steps:


How to link your phone and your Android TV using Google app for Android TV




Before you can install apps on your Android TV from your phone, you need to link your phone and your Android TV using the Google app for Android TV. This app allows you to control your Android TV with your phone, as well as send apps and games from your phone to your TV. To link your phone and your Android TV using Google app for Android TV, follow these steps:



  • Install and open the Google app for Android TV on your phone. You can download it from the Google Play Store.



  • Make sure that your phone and your Android TV are connected to the same Wi-Fi network.



  • On your phone, tap on the Devices icon at the bottom of the screen.



  • You will see a list of devices that are available to connect. Tap on the name of your Android TV.



  • A code will appear on your TV screen. Enter the code on your phone and tap on Pair.



  • You have now linked your phone and your Android TV using Google app for Android TV. You can proceed to the next step.
